    3. Hi Scott, Juanita and Anna! According to her death certificate, my great-great-grandmother, Matilda Catherine 'Tilda' House, was born 20 Feb 1854 in Arkansas.. She married Thomas Hemphill Peter 'Pea' Roberts about 1870 presumably in the vicinity Fulton County in north Arkansas where his family lived. Plesant Sidney Roberts, her first son arrived on 6 May 1871. Pea and Tilda raised their own family in the vicinity of Salem, Camp and Wheeling in Fulton County, Arkansas and Howell County, Missouri. However, sometime after 1900 (probably during the oil boom during the first World War), they moved to El Dorado, Butler County, Kansas where they lived until their deaths. Family legend had it that Tilda was an American Indian - Choctaw or Cherokee or whatever. She was supposed to have been adopted as a child and raised by a white family named Evans or maybe House - we're just not sure. Her grandson and my grandfather, Ernest Roberts, in a video taped interview in 1989, stated that his grandmother was a 'full blooded Indian' although he didn't know the tribe. The photos of her taken 24 Oct 1915 show her to be diminutive lady, but do not show any facial features I could characterize as 'Indian.' Surnames: LOOMIS, HOUSE Classification: Query Message Board URL: http://boards.ancestry.com/mbexec/msg/rw/SFk.2ACIB/1252 Message Board Post: I have a very old album that came from the home of Caroline "Carrie" (BROWN) ADAMS in the Grand Rapids, MI area. She married in 1901, Elmer ADAMS, who had been previously married to a Mary LOOMIS, daughter of George W. LOOMIS. I believe this album, with very few identified pictures, had been from his first family. In it were several pictures of a young man in various poses and costumes and there was also an advertisement with the same pictures titled "THE JUVENILE GRADUATE Master Lou House." The ad states "The above little Artist having played the principal theatres in Europe and America, is a sufficient guarantee that he has had a thorough schooling in all branches of the profession, and thereby winning for himself the proud title of 'THE JUVENILE GRADUATE.' As a Singer, Trick Dancer, Commedian and Change Artist, he stands without a rival; and is a powerful drawing card." Can anyone tell me anything about this person or this family?
